Frequently Asked Questions
When is the best time to begin sinus and allergy acupuncture?
Ideally, we recommend beginning treatment 4-6 weeks before your typical allergy season begins, as this allows time to regulate immune response and reduce reactivity. However, acupuncture provides benefits at any stage—whether you're experiencing acute symptoms, managing chronic sinusitis, or seeking preventive care for recurring seasonal issues.

How frequently will I need sinus and allergy acupuncture treatments?
For most clients with sinus and allergy issues, we recommend weekly treatments for at least 6-8 sessions to establish improved patterns. Treatment frequency may increase during acute flare-ups or peak allergy seasons. Your specific treatment plan will be tailored to your individual needs, symptom patterns, and whether you're combining acupuncture with conventional treatments.
